Dermatographia Urticaria
I still have problem of dermatographaia urticaria. I have changed 4 doctors. Once I go for homeopathy treatment, but then I switch again for allopathy as it is not curing me at all. So I go for best doctor of Derma as prescribed by my family doctor. Then the doctor prescribed me teczine levocetirizine 5 mg tablets and rabeprazole sodium and domperidone and also a blood test and actually I am not remember about test as it was 1 year ago. And in the blood report, it have disastrous values. Something is very high that causes this problem. Its value is 615+ value and my doctor said it must be 150 to control this. So after that he increase my dose for 2 months teczine levocetirizine 10 mg tablets and then after that 2 months 5 mg again and after one month when I go to doctor again he said continue these tablets and told me to do blood test again. So I did it again and this time its value is 400 around, so doctor says continue these tablets and come in between. What to do?
